Title: Approve a resolution directing the publication of an Official Notice of Intention to Issue $156,265,000 City of Austin, Texas, Certificates of Obligation, Series 2026 in one or more series related to fire and emergency medical service stations, administrative office buildings, a family violence shelter, bridges and dams, public safety facilities, park improvements, street and road improvements, and Waller Creek District improvements. Summary

The City of Austin's Resolution No. 26-1826, adopted on May 28, 2026, outlines the intention to issue up to $156.3 million in Certificates of Obligation. This funding is designated for various public projects, including public safety facilities, park improvements, administrative offices, and infrastructure enhancements like streets and drainage systems. These initiatives aim to support community safety and enhance public amenities. The resolution mandates the publication of a notice regarding this intent, ensuring transparency and public awareness. The funds will reimburse prior expenditures and are projected to be paid back through tax levies and limited surplus revenues.
